I think there's a logical conclusion to explain the disparity between
in-state and out-of-state submissions. I think most PA operators are
casual operators that are participating more because it's the PA QSO
Party. Outside of a few former Pennsylvania residents, most of the
out-of-state participants are into serious contesting and are in the
event because it's a contest. I'm not saying that either is worse or
better than the other, just that each group is participating for
different reasons outside of the core motivation to have fun. The
numbers on 3830 would support this conclusion. Some of the serial
number exchanges I got from folks in states like GA and TX which greatly
exceeded the average numbers I was seeing from PA stations told me many
of these people were serious contest ops.
